Study Summary

The goal of the current project is to fill the unmet clinical needs around the objective assessment of visual function and develop outcome-oriented visual rehabilitation approach using the computer assisted rehabilitation environment (CAREN) system for Argus recipients.

What the Registry Record Tells You About NCT03444961

The ClinicalTrials.gov registry entry for NCT03444961 describes a study currently listed as completed, categorized as NA. The registered enrollment target is 4 participants, a figure that helps gauge the scale of data the investigators plan to collect, below the 261-participant average among 37 other Retinitis Pigmentosa trials with a reported enrollment target (98% lower). The listed sponsor is The Cleveland Clinic, which has 688 total studies on file at ClinicalTrials.gov.

The record links to 1 condition, with Retinitis Pigmentosa appearing as the primary indexed condition, and to 1 intervention - of which CAREN system training is the first listed.

NCT03444961 reports 1 study location spanning 1 distinct geographic area - top geographies include Ohio.
